The Compliance & Contract Consultant is an individual contributor role that will be responsible to support Compliance programs spanning financial, licensing, regulatory filing, data use (Artificial Intelligence/Machine Learning), and governance compliance matters across all UHC lines of business.

Accountabilities will include monitoring changes to the regulatory environment to ensure compliance with state and federal law, regulations, mandates, and contractual requirements. The position will establish and implement standard policies, procedures, and best practice across UHC. Other duties may include conducting legal research, supporting regulatory filings, and preparing contract amendments relating to intersegment agreements.

Primary Responsibilities:

  • Collaborate cross-functionally with legal, regulatory affairs, business partners and other compliance professionals to promote compliant outcomes and mitigate risk with applicable regulatory and contractual requirements across multiple products
  • Evaluate Compliance program function and infrastructure to offer recommendations to drive improvement and build monitoring processes
  • Project manage multiple work plan initiatives as assigned by leadership that strive to achieve desired objectives under structured timeframes
  • Conduct research to identify applicable requirements relating to different product offerings, license types, use of data, and financial reporting requirements
  • Draft regulatory appendices and supporting process to ensure they are in accordance with all applicable regulation. Also will peer review other intersegment agreements to ensure quality
  • Influence, lead and collaborate within a matrixed Compliance, Legal and Regulatory team and with highly matrixed business partners across UHC, Optum and other delegated entities

Required Qualifications:

  • Degree or equivalent experience: Bachelors in Healthcare or Business and/or regulatory managed care experience
  • 5+ years of experience working in a government, healthcare, managed care and/or health insurance environment in a regulatory, or compliance role
  • Experience with MS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int)
  • Knowledge of data privacy, governance, licensing, filing and financial regulations that govern HMOs and other regulated license types

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Professional certification (Certified in Healthcare Compliance (CHC) or similar)
  • Contracting experience
  • Legal research / paralegal experience
  • Knowledge of Medicaid, Medicare, and Commercial health insurance products
